The electrical service already in a Duval County house does more to shape a water heater installation than the unit itself. Half the homes in Duval County, Texas were built in 1980 or earlier (2020-2024 ACS 5-year). Wiring put in for the demands of that era was sized for what appliances drew then, and a new water heater may pull more than the existing service was laid out to handle. A contractor will open the panel and check capacity before the equipment question gets answered.

What a Water Heater Installation Covers

Isometric cutaway illustration of a small single-story house showing interior rooms with sinks, a toilet, furniture and a tall cylindrical water heater with a flue pipe extending through the dark shingled roof.

The tank or tankless unit is the heart of the system. A storage tank sits in a utility closet, garage, or basement and holds a supply of heated water ready to draw from. A tankless unit mounts on a wall and heats water as it moves through.

The unit connects to cold water supply lines coming into the house and to hot water lines running out to every fixture. A pressure relief valve mounts directly on the unit as a safety device, and the flue or exhaust vent runs from the unit to an exterior wall or roof to carry combustion gases out.

The drawing shows a general layout of these components, and a licensed contractor determines exactly what applies to your home and its existing setup.
